To be or not to be an entrepreneur? What drives or hinders an entrepreneurially capable individual to step into active entrepreneurship? A multi method, multi perspective analysis
Author
Abstract
The question “Why do some and not others become entrepreneurs?” has been broadly researched. Paradoxically, entrepreneurial propensity and entrepreneurial capability do not seem to go together automatically. This PhD research investigated the development of entrepreneurial propensity among individuals who possess strong entrepreneurial capabilities. The call for ambitious entrepreneurship justifies to research the activation of nonentrepreneurs who are positioned high on the entrepreneurial capability dimension. Qualitative research broadened our scope with insights given by the target group of entrepreneurially capable individuals. The results of the quantitative research allow us to present conclusions, that are concise and simple. The work also suggests how these answers can be further applied by individuals, career coaches and policymakers.
